@selection-change解释他的功能
时间: 2024-05-22 08:12:49 浏览: 158
@selection-change是一个事件触发器,用于在文本编辑器中监测选择区域的变化。当用户在编辑器中选择文本时,@selection-change将会被触发并传递相关的参数信息,例如前一个选择区域的范围、当前选择区域的范围等等。开发人员可以使用@selection-change来实现一些实时的文本处理操作,例如高亮显示选中文本、统计选中文本的字符数等等。
相关问题
@selection-change
@selection-change是一个事件,它在多选框被选中时触发。 在代码示例中,@selection-change="handleSelectionChange"表示当多选框的选中状态发生变化时,会调用名为handleSelectionChange的方法。<span class="em">1</span><span class="em">2</span><span class="em">3</span>
#### 引用[.reference_title]
- *1* [vue element 表格多选框的使用心得selection-change和row-click](https://blog.csdn.net/zgl1351019870/article/details/112005563)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v92^chatsearchT0_1"}}] [.reference_item style="max-width: 33.333333333333336%"]
- *2* [vue+element+Java实现批量删除功能](https://download.csdn.net/download/weixin_38633157/13976621)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v92^chatsearchT0_1"}}] [.reference_item style="max-width: 33.333333333333336%"]
- *3* [VUE中 复选框选中事件@selection-change的坑](https://blog.csdn.net/qq_16397653/article/details/127257239)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v92^chatsearchT0_1"}}] [.reference_item style="max-width: 33.333333333333336%"]
[ .reference_list ]
<el-table border :data="addDataList" @selection-change="handleSelectionChange">使用虚拟滚动
使用Element UI提供的虚拟滚动功能可以优化表格的性能,具体实现方法如下:
1. 在el-table组件上添加一个属性 :row-height="40",其中40是每一行的高度(根据实际情况进行调整)。
2. 添加一个属性 :virtual-scroll="true"来启用虚拟滚动功能。
以下是修改后的代码示例:
```
<el-table border :data="addDataList" @selection-change="handleSelectionChange" :row-height="40" :virtual-scroll="true">
<!-- 表格列定义 -->
</el-table>
```
这样就可以实现虚拟滚动功能,只渲染当前可视区域的行,而不是全部渲染,大大提高了表格的渲染性能。
阅读全文